Ассоциация ЭБНИТ    ИРБИС-корпорация    Вики-Ирбис    Online/CHM справка Ирбис   
АРМ Комплектатор :  ИРБИС Irbis
 
Выходная форма TKSUMWG
Пользователь: kharlamova_n (IP-адрес скрыт)
Дата: 27, September, 2008 11:11

Выходная форма TKSUMWG
Пользователь: kharlamova_n (IP-адрес скрыт)
Дата: 20, September, 2008 14:08


Здравствуйте! Мы бы хотели в выходной форме TKSUMWG в разделе "По языкам" добавить учет по английскому, немецкому и французскому языкам, то есть чтобы в этом разделе было 6 граф: рус, нац, англ, нем, фран и др. Сейчас есть только 3 графы: рус, нац и др. Подскажите, пожалуйста, какие элементы данных из ТАБЛИЦЫ 2. ФОРМАТ ПРЕДСТАВЛЕНИЯ ДАННЫХ В БАЗЕ ДАННЫХ КОМПЛЕКТОВАНИЯ использовать для английского, немецкого и французского языка. Для русского языка - ЭД 44^q, для нац.языка - ЭД 44^r, для др.языков - ЭД 44^s.


Опции: Ответить•Цитировать
Re: Выходная форма TKSUMWG
Пользователь: Дунаевская (IP-адрес скрыт)
Дата: 22, September, 2008 22:58


В расширенных данных распределения - поле 149

Вы не могли бы более подробно ответить, напишите конкретно какой формат надо использовать для английского языка, какой для немецкого и какой для французского. И, кстати, где в документации описываются расширенные данные распределения?

Re: Выходная форма TKSUMWG
Пользователь: Дунаевская (IP-адрес скрыт)
Дата: 29, September, 2008 12:42

Я ошиблась. В форме TKSUMWG (по подразделениям) данные берутся из полей 44 (а не из 149).
Вам нужно в rksu.fst добавить новые строки для формирования дополнительных подполей в поле 44 на основе строки 44^Q (44^T, 44^U, 44^V ...), заменяя во фрагменте
... if &unifor('Av101#1'):'rus'then ... код rus на eng, fre, spa и т.д.
Затем добавить вывод этих новых подполей в форму (Генератор табличных форм)



Извините, только зарегистрированные пользователи могут писать в этом форуме.
This forum powered by Phorum.